Cons-Iedu: Islamic Guidance and Counseling Journal
ISSN : 27985040     EISSN : 27983218     DOI : https://doi.org/10.51192/cons.v1i02.163
CONS-IEDU is a scientific journal published by the Islamic Guidance and Counseling Study Program, Faculty of Tarbiyah and Teacher Training at the Ummul Quro Al-Islami Institute, Bogor since 2021. This journal publishes scientific research results in developing concepts and theories related to the study of Guidance and Counseling Islam includes Islamic education counseling guidance, Islamic mental counseling guidance, Islamic career counseling guidance, Sakinah family counseling guidance, post-disaster counseling guidance, Islamic Spiritual counseling guidance; Islamic counseling: social-religious counseling, counseling on drug control, family planning counseling, adolescent counseling; BKI media: Islamic e-counseling; Islamic training, and Islamic motivation. Manuscripts that enter the journal editor before publication will pass an assessment through a double blind review, meaning that neither the author nor the reviewer know each other

Abstract

The counseling relationship is a key element in an effective counseling process. This relationship is characterized by trust, empathy, and open communication between the counselor and the client. However, in practice, there are various barriers that can interfere with the realization of an optimal counseling relationship. This study aims to identify the main barriers in building a counseling relationship and explore strategies to overcome them. The identified barriers include internal client factors, such as distrust, fear of stigma, and difficulty in expressing emotions; and external factors, such as lack of counselor competence, cultural differences, and an unsupportive counseling environment. In addition, interpersonal dynamics such as perceptual bias and value conflicts can also affect the quality of the counseling relationship. The results of the study indicate that an empathy-based approach, effective communication, and cultural awareness can help reduce these barriers. This abstract provides insights for counselors to improve the effectiveness of counseling practice by strengthening inclusive and supportive counseling relationships

Abstract

Children in orphanages have difficulty establishing open communication with the environment. This is due to self-and-external factors, so it becomes an inhibiting factor in the process of children's self-development in orphanages. The purpose of this study was to find out: (1) the condition of children's self-openness in orphanages before and after being given group guidance services with homeroom techniques, and (2) the effectiveness of group guidance services with homeroom techniques in increasing children's self-disclosure in orphanages. The method in this study is quantitative with the type of pre-experimental research and the research design uses one group pretest-posttest design. Sampling in this study used purposive sampling techniques. This study had a study population of 30 children and the study sample was 8 children who had low self-disclosure at the Mamiyai Al-Ittihadiyah Medan Orphanage. The instrument used is the self-disclosure scale with the Likert scale model. The data collected were analyzed with non-parametric statistics using the Wilcoxon signed rank test and assisted through the SPSS program version 22. The results explained that the pretest score was 82 and the post-test was 129.75, which means that there is an increase in the self-disclosure of children in orphanages. Furthermore, it is supported by the results of the hypothesis test which shows that asymp.sig (2-tailed) of 0.012 which is below alpha 0.05 (0.012<0.05) which means that Ho's hypothesis is rejected and Ha is accepted. Based on the results obtained, it can be concluded that group guidance services with homeroom techniques are effective in increasing children's self-disclosure at the Mamiyai Al-Ittihadiyah Medan Orphanage

Abstract

To find out the hedonistic lifestyle of students before being given information services assisted by short film media, secondly to find out how the implementation of information services assisted by short film media in reducing hedonistic lifestyles in students, and thirdly to find out how effective the information service assisted by short film media is in reducing the hedonistic lifestyle of students. hedonistic life among students in the Islamic counseling study program. The type of research used was quantitative with experimental methods, while the design used in this research was one group pretest-posttest using a sample of 59 people, and was selected again using a purposive sampling technique with a total of 8 students who were given treatment. Data collection techniques use Likert scale questionnaires and documentation. Meanwhile, data analysis used the Wilcoxon test. The results of the study showed that the level of students' hedonistic lifestyle before being given treatment was in the high category with an average value (M) = 80.375, and after being given treatment was in the low category with M = 43.625. Wilcoxon test analysis produced a score of Z = -2.524 which shows that information services assisted by short film media are effective in reducing hedonistic lifestyles in students of the Islamic Counseling Guidance study program at UIN Raden Fatah Palembang

Abstract

This research is motivated by the increase in cases of online gambling addiction, especially slots, among students. This addiction hurts students' academic, social, and psychological lives, so effective intervention is needed to overcome it. The purpose of this research is to find out the picture and effectiveness of group counseling with the thought-stopping technique to reduce online gambling addiction in students. The population is 85 students of the BPI study program, the sample taken is 8 people using the purposive sampling technique, which is a method of drawing non-random sampling samples that is carried out with certain criteria. Data collection techniques include using questionnaires or questionnaires and documentation. Data analysis techniques using the Wilcoxon Signed Rank Test measure the significance of the difference between two populations based on samples.The results of this study concluded that the average pretest before M(SD) was 86,714 (3,773) and after the post-test M(SD) was 51,875 (5,194) Experiencing a decrease in online gambling addiction. Wilcoxon test results With Zscore = -2.533 with a significance value of 0.011 The results showed a difference between before and after group counseling with the thought-stopping technique
